Perhaps it would be helpful to explain to the OP (and others who may read this) why folks are able to state that the bed in 8218 is by the bath.  When you look at the deck plan and see the square icon for a Sofa Bed in a specific cabin, you know that cabin has the bed by the bath.  The cabins alternate, bed by bath, bed by balcony.  If the cabin you are interested in doesn't show any such icon (8218 doesn't), find the nearest cabin that does, and count from there.   In this case, we see the square icon in 8222 as well as in 8214, which means that 8222 and 8214 both have the bed by the bath, and so does 8218. 

 

I hope that's helpful.

Haven't been on Silhouette since the refit, but the layout of the stateroom is pretty much the same -- just the décor has changed.  Your stateroom doesn't have the pull out sofa bed (square), but has the upper berth (triangle), when not used is flush with the overhead.
